Join Santa at Cribbs This Christmas for the Ultimate Festive Family Day Out

Join Santa at Cribbs this Christmas for the ultimate festive family day out, all totally free of charge!

From November 29th, wind your way through our magical Stick Man trail, following the beloved Christmas character as he finds his way home to the family tree.

Then settle down with Santa and his Forest Elves for storytelling, festive fun and elfish entertainment.
All the fun is totally free for all to enjoy, no need to book just turn up to join the festivities.

Stick Man Trail – open throughout the day from 29th November. Free trail booklet for Cribbs & Me Rewards users from the Information Desk.

Santa Storytelling & Entertainment –
Weekday Mornings: 10.00 – 13.00 (10.00 – 17.00 from the 16th December)
Saturdays: 10.00 – 17.00
Sundays: 11.00 – 17.00
